Lagos State: US Envoy Lauds Fashola’s Agric Scheme

United States Agriculture Attaché in Nigeria, Mr. Ali Abdi, has commended the Lagos State Governor, Mr. Babatunde Fashola (SAN) for initiating the Agriculture Youth Empowerment Scheme (YES), saying it is the path to meaningful agricultural development in the state and Nigeria.  

He said the programmme showed a real commitment to address the issue of food shortage in the state and promoting the economic development of the state especially in the area of employment generation at the local level.

Speaking at an interactive session with students of the Lagos Agric-YES programme at Araga, Epe in Lagos, on “Role of Agriculture in Community Development”, Abdi tasked the students to live up to the expectation of them in boosting food production in the state, adding that if efforts like this is initiated in other parts of the country, it would spur agriculture revolution in the country.

He said the US government, like every other government around the world, was concerned about the devastating effects climate change hence the Climate Change Summit in Copenhagen, Denmark, adding that the US is especially concerned about how it affects agricultural production in Africa. 
The United States is concerned about the negative effects of climate change an all facets of life of people around the globe, he said at the interactive session with the students.  

According to him, despite the challenges of climate change, Nigeria still has a climate that supports agricultural production all the year round, explaining that the government needs to take advantage of that by giving more boosts to agriculture.
